The Rise and Plateau of Livestream Selling

Livestream selling, or livestream commerce, exploded onto the scene in recent years, transforming the retail landscape. We witnessed small businesses and large corporations alike leveraging platforms to engage directly with consumers, showcase products in real-time, and drive immediate sales. This interactive approach offered a unique blend of entertainment and commerce, creating a sense of urgency and community that traditional e-commerce often lacked. I remember witnessing, first-hand, a small business owner in Hanoi who completely revitalized her handmade jewelry business through consistent and engaging livestreams. Her sales skyrocketed, and she built a loyal customer base that extended far beyond her local community. However, recent data suggests that the initial hyper-growth phase may be leveling off. Consumer attention spans are increasingly fragmented, and the novelty of livestreaming is wearing off for some. Competition has intensified, and the cost of acquiring and retaining viewers is rising. This begs the question: is livestream selling still a viable strategy for businesses in the long term?

The AI Revolution: Transforming Livestream Dynamics

The emergence of Artificial Intelligence (AI) is poised to fundamentally reshape the dynamics of livestream selling. AI-powered tools are already being implemented to enhance various aspects of the process, from content creation and audience engagement to product recommendations and order fulfillment. For example, AI algorithms can analyze viewer data in real-time to personalize product suggestions, optimize pricing strategies, and even automate customer service interactions. Furthermore, AI can assist in generating engaging content by creating dynamic visuals, scripting compelling narratives, and even translating content into multiple languages to reach a wider audience. In my view, the key to successful livestream selling in the future lies in harnessing the power of AI to create more personalized, efficient, and engaging experiences for viewers.

AI-Driven Personalization and Enhanced Engagement

One of the most significant impacts of AI on livestream selling will be the ability to deliver highly personalized experiences. Imagine a livestream where the products showcased are tailored to each individual viewer’s preferences, based on their past purchases, browsing history, and even real-time sentiment analysis. This level of personalization can significantly increase engagement and conversion rates. AI-powered chatbots can also handle routine customer inquiries, freeing up human agents to focus on more complex issues. I have observed that viewers are more likely to purchase from livestreams that offer a personalized and responsive experience. Moreover, AI can analyze viewer feedback in real-time to identify areas for improvement and optimize the livestream content accordingly. This iterative approach ensures that the livestream remains relevant and engaging for its target audience.

Automated Operations and Supply Chain Optimization

Beyond personalization, AI can streamline and automate various operational aspects of livestream selling. For example, AI-powered inventory management systems can predict demand fluctuations and optimize stock levels to minimize waste and ensure timely delivery. AI can also automate order fulfillment processes, reducing errors and improving efficiency. Furthermore, AI can be used to optimize shipping routes and delivery schedules, reducing transportation costs and improving customer satisfaction. These operational efficiencies can significantly improve profitability and competitiveness in the increasingly crowded livestream selling market. The ability to seamlessly integrate AI into the supply chain and operational processes will be a critical differentiator for businesses seeking to thrive in the future.

Future Strategies for Livestream Success in the AI Era

To navigate the evolving landscape of livestream selling in the AI era, businesses need to adopt proactive and strategic approaches. Firstly, it is crucial to invest in AI-powered tools and technologies that can enhance personalization, engagement, and operational efficiency. Secondly, businesses need to develop a deep understanding of their target audience and tailor their livestream content accordingly. This requires continuous monitoring of viewer data, sentiment analysis, and experimentation with different content formats and strategies. Thirdly, building a strong brand identity and fostering a loyal community are essential for long-term success. This can be achieved through consistent and authentic communication, interactive engagement, and exclusive offers for loyal customers. Finally, businesses need to adapt to the ever-changing technological landscape and be prepared to experiment with new platforms and strategies. I believe that those who embrace AI and prioritize customer experience will be best positioned to thrive in the future of livestream selling.
